Sentence info.
The Indonesian sentence "Aku akan membantumu menyeberangi pagar kuning jika aku bisa" is structured as follows:
– Aku: An informal way to say "I."
– akan: A modal verb meaning "will," used here to express intention.
– membantu: A verb meaning "to help."
– -mu: A suffix attached to "membantu," meaning "your," which indicates that the help is directed towards "you."
– menyeberangi: A verb meaning "to cross."
– pagar kuning: "Pagar" means "fence," and "kuning" means "yellow," so together it means "yellow fence."
– jika: A conjunction meaning "if."
– aku bisa: "Aku" means "I," and "bisa" means "can" or "could," expressing the speaker's capability.
Tips to remember:
1. Focus on the structure "Subject + akan + verb + object + jika + condition". This structure is common for conditional statements in Bahasa Indonesia.
2. Remember that "akan" indicates future intention or willingness, while "bisa" indicates ability.
Alternate ways to convey the same meaning:
1. "Saya akan menolongmu menyeberang pagar kuning kalau saya bisa."
2. "Kalau saya bisa, saya akan membantumu melewati pagar kuning."
3. "Jika dapat, aku akan bantu kamu melintas pagar kuning."
4. "Aku akan membantu kamu melewati pagar kuning andai aku bisa."
